The Village Recorder is a famous recording studio in Los Angeles, California. Since the 1960s, The Village has been the home to recordings by artists such as Aerosmith, The Allman Brothers, The Beach Boys, Fleetwood Mac, Mariah Carey, Johnny Cash, Ray Charles, Eric Clapton, Alice Cooper, Elvis Costello, The Doors, Bob Dylan, The Eagles, George Harrison, Elton John, Tom Jones, B.B. King, John Lennon, Little Richard, The Smashing Pumpkins, Ringo Starr, Ozzy Osbourne, Tina Turner, Guns N' Roses, Grateful Dead, Madonna and Crosby, Stills and Nash.
